As businesses increasingly embrace cloud-based solutions, Software as a Service (SaaS) is revolutionizing the landscape of software delivery. Yet, with these advancements come profound ethical considerations, especially for reseller-friendly SaaS models. This article delves into the myriad of ethical challenges and responsibilities that SaaS providers face when they empower resellers to distribute their products. We will explore the intricacies of data privacy, user consent, potential biases in algorithms, and the importance of regulatory compliance, all while providing a roadmap for navigating these turbulent waters.
- Overview of Ethical Considerations in SaaS
- Ethics in SaaS Development
- Ethics in SaaS Deployment
- The Role of Regulatory Compliance in SaaS
- Case Studies: Real-World Ethical Challenges in SaaS
Overview of Ethical Considerations in SaaS
The ethical domain of SaaS represents a vast landscape that incorporates principles guiding the development and deployment of software services. Understanding the ethical considerations in SaaS is crucial, especially in an era when data breaches and privacy violations seem to appear as frequently as new features.
One of the principal components of ethics in SaaS involves ensuring responsible data handling. Companies such as Shopify and BigCommerce, known for their robust SaaS platforms, need to prioritize ethical programming practices that protect user data. Ethical programming is about coding thoughtfully to avoid biases and ensure transparency. For instance, a company using an algorithm that decides loan eligibility must critically assess whether it inadvertently discriminates against certain demographic groups. Failure to do so not only invites financial risk but can lead to significant lawsuits and reputational damage.
Another critical aspect is user consent. SaaS providers must implement systems that allow users to give informed consent before their data is collected and processed. This requirement isn’t just an ethical imperative; it’s also becoming a legal necessity globally, with regulations such as the GDPR and the CCPA holding companies accountable.
Ensuring data privacy and building trust with users are crucial for the success of any SaaS business model, particularly for resellers who act as intermediaries. When privacy breaches occur, the fallout can damage not just the SaaS provider but also the resellers who depend on their products for business growth. Hence, creating a culture of ethical oversight is necessary for sustaining long-term relationships in reseller ecosystems.
| Key Ethical Considerations | Description |
|---|---|
| Data Privacy | Importance of safeguarding user data against unauthorized access. |
| User Consent | Ensuring users are well-informed before data collection. |
| Algorithmic Fairness | Avoiding biases in decision-making algorithms to promote equity. |
Building trust and transparency with customers not only curtails risk but fosters an environment where ethical practices can flourish. As we explore the nuances of SaaS, we will see how these values permeate through the development and deployment phases.

Ethics in SaaS Development
The development phase of SaaS is where ethical considerations first take root, and it demands rigorous attention. Developers must implement ethical programming practices that encompass transparency, accountability, and inclusivity. For example, if an e-commerce SaaS tool is designed with built-in features to analyze customer behavior, developers need to ensure that these features do not perpetuate discrimination.
Accessibility is another pillar of ethical programming. SaaS providers should strive to build tools that cater to a diverse user base, including those with disabilities. Incorporating accessibility features not only fulfills ethical responsibilities but can open new markets. Companies like WooCommerce and Magento have adopted these inclusive practices to enhance user experience across various demographics.
Data privacy concerns also intersect with development practices. By including robust security measures like encryption and ethical data handling protocols in the software’s architecture, developers can safeguard user data more effectively. Moreover, educating users about these practices fosters a culture of security awareness. A solid approach can convert an ethical compliance obligation into a marketing advantage, showcasing the platform’s reliability to potential resellers and users.
A significant aspect of development ethics involves the disclosure and management of software bugs and vulnerabilities. Ethical developers prioritize addressing these issues swiftly. They should practice responsible disclosure, ensuring that vulnerabilities are managed before they can be exploited. This means not just patching bugs but also communicating transparently with users about potential risks and necessary actions.
- Implementing Security Measures: Developers should integrate encryption, data anonymization, and regular security audits.
- Ensuring Accessibility: Features that cater to individuals with disabilities must be a design priority.
- Promoting User Education: Educate users on data protection practices to enhance overall trust.
| Practice | Ethical Implication |
|---|---|
| Data Anonymization | Protects personal information during analysis. |
| Robust Security Protocols | Prevents unauthorized access and data breaches. |
| Transparency in Coding | Encourages accountability and allows scrutiny. |
As we delve deeper into the deployment of SaaS solutions, we will uncover the additional ethical considerations that must be navigated in order to support resellers effectively.

Ethics in SaaS Deployment
Deployment is where the ethics in SaaS delivery are put to the test. This phase necessitates a focus on three core ethical responsibilities: securing user consent, mitigating unintended consequences, and ensuring ethical disclosure practices. Each of these aspects plays a pivotal role in the ongoing relationship between the SaaS provider, the reseller, and the end user.
Securing informed user consent during deployment is not just a recommended practice; it’s a vital ethical obligation. Users should be given clear communication about how their data is utilized and the options available to them regarding their information. Implementing opt-in systems, where users willingly agree to data collection, enhances trust and accountability.
Unintended consequences arise in deployment scenarios, requiring a vigilant approach from SaaS providers and resellers. Failure to assess the potential repercussions of a deployed solution can lead to severe issues, such as accessibility barriers or data handling problems. For example, when launching new features, it’s essential to conduct impact assessments to identify how the changes affect user experience and privacy. A reputable SaaS platform should remain proactive, continually monitoring the impact of their service on its users.
Ethical disclosure practices also underpin responsible SaaS deployment. Users have a right to know what technologies are in use, where their data is stored, and the infrastructure behind the SaaS solutions they utilize. Ensuring transparency throughout the deployment process cultivates trust and fosters long-lasting relationships. Companies like Squarespace and Recurly have embraced ethical disclosure as part of their brand ethos, enhancing their credibility among users and resellers alike.
-
Ensure Transparent User Agreements:
Users should have clear access to terms regarding data usage. -
Conduct Risk Assessments:
Evaluate how new features can impact existing user workflows or privacy. -
Maintain Open Communication:
Regular updates about changes in services or policies strengthen transparency.
| Ethical Strategy | Implementation |
|---|---|
| User Consent Mechanism | Implement easily understandable opt-in processes for users. |
| Impact Analysis | This involves continuous assessment of service impact on users. |
| Feedback Loops | Create channels for users to communicate their concerns or suggestions. |
Examining the regulatory landscape will shed light on the obligations that SaaS providers must meet to maintain ethical standards.
The Role of Regulatory Compliance in Ethical SaaS
Regulatory compliance serves as both a framework and a guiding principle in fostering ethical conduct in SaaS development and deployment. This section elucidates the significance of understanding regulatory frameworks and the ethical implications of compliance.
SaaS providers must navigate complex legal landscapes, embodied in regulations such as the General Data Protection Regulation (GDPR) and the California Consumer Privacy Act (CCPA). These regulations set clear guidelines regarding data collection, processing, and dissemination, making it imperative for providers to be well-versed in these legalities.
Furthermore, non-compliance can incur severe penalties. Businesses that violate data privacy laws may face hefty fines, which can hinder their operations and undermine user trust. In the European Union, for instance, non-compliance with GDPR can cost a company up to €20 million or 4% of its global revenue, whichever is higher. For many SaaS providers, this can be devastating.
Conversely, compliance fosters a culture of ethical conduct and accountability within organizations. When companies adhere to regulatory requirements, they signal their commitment to uphold user rights and establish transparent practices. Ethical software solutions, coupled with adherence to legal standards, can distinguish a provider in an increasingly competitive marketplace.
-
Understanding Regulatory Frameworks:
SaaS providers should remain informed about laws applicable to their operations. -
Action Plans for Compliance:
Organizations need concrete plans outlining how they will maintain compliance. -
Ongoing Training:
Regular staff training ensures that all employees are aware of compliance protocols.
| Regulation | Key Requirements |
|---|---|
| GDPR | Consent for data processing, data protection impact assessments. |
| CCPA | Disclosure of data utilization, rights to opt-out of data selling. |
| FERPA | Protection of student education records. |
Gleaning lessons from real-world case studies will provide additional clarity on the ethical challenges faced in SaaS.
Case Studies: Real-World Ethical Challenges in SaaS
Examining real-world case studies serves as an invaluable method for understanding the ethical challenges facing SaaS providers today. By analyzing how different companies tackle these issues, we can extract powerful lessons to enhance ethical practices in SaaS development and deployment.
For instance, let’s consider a well-known data breach incident involving a widely-used SaaS provider. The breach not only exposed sensitive user information but also highlighted the inadequacies in their data protection protocols. As a result, the organization faced intense public scrutiny and lost the trust of its customers and resellers. This incident demonstrates that the repercussions of ethical negligence can be immediate and long-lasting.
Another illustrative case involved a company that failed to provide adequate accessibility features in its SaaS products. Users with disabilities highlighted the barriers they faced. The backlash led the company to reevaluate its development practices, ultimately adapting its offerings to include features that catered to a diverse user base. This transition not only addressed ethical shortcomings but also opened up new revenue streams by reaching previously overlooked customers.
- Identity Theft Incident: A data breach exposed user data, resulting in lawsuits and hefty fines.
- Accessibility Failures: Shortcomings in service accessibility led to public backlash and rectifications.
- Privacy Violations: Companies that mishandle data may face regulatory scrutiny and financial penalties.
| Case Study | Ethical Challenge | Resolution |
|---|---|---|
| Company A | Data Breach | Enhanced security protocols and user notifications. |
| Company B | Lack of Accessibility | Launched inclusive design initiatives. |
| Company C | Privacy Non-compliance | Revised data collection policies to align with regulations. |
The lessons learned from these real-world ethical challenges serve as a guiding beacon for SaaS providers aiming to refine their practices.
FAQ
What are the main ethical considerations in developing SaaS?
Key ethical considerations include data privacy, algorithmic fairness, ensuring user consent, and accountability during development.
How does regulatory compliance influence SaaS practices?
Regulatory compliance establishes a framework for ethical conduct by requiring companies to protect user data and uphold user rights, which fosters trust.
What happens when a SaaS company breaches ethical guidelines?
Breach of ethical guidelines can lead to legal penalties, loss of customer trust, and damage to reputation, which can be catastrophic for business sustainability.
Why is transparency important in SaaS?
Transparency builds trust with users and resellers and ensures accountability for data handling practices and software functionalities.
How can SaaS providers ensure the ethical use of their products?
Providers can include features that promote ethical use, engage a Data Protection Officer, and educate their customers about compliance and ethical standards.

